Terence D’Souza has stepped down from his role as chief creative officer and associate partner at hotstuff medialabs, concluding a twelve-year stint at the 360° communications agency.
D’Souza cited health reasons for his departure, following a brain stroke last year. Having now recovered, he is looking forward to starting a refreshed chapter in his media career, he stated.
D’Souza said, "Hotstuff has always had a legacy of bold thinking and courageous execution of new ideas. I'm confident the team will continue to rise to the challenge."
In a career spanning over 17 years, D’Souza began as a qualified auditor before pivoting to advertising in 2012, when he took on the role of CCO at hotstuff medialabs.
